    The SAP error message 62615, which states "Enter an existing business entity or interval," typically occurs in the context of business partner or customer/vendor master data management. This error indicates that the system is expecting a valid business entity (such as a customer, vendor, or business partner) or a valid interval (such as a range of values) to be entered, but the input provided does not match any existing records in the system.
    Causes:
    
    Non-Existent Business Entity: The business entity you are trying to reference does not exist in the system. This could be due to a typo or because the entity has not been created yet.
    Incorrect Input Format: The input format may not match the expected format for business entities or intervals.
    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ary permissions to view or access the business entities.
